HOW TO ENTER: To enter the Win A Trip to Tuscany Sweepstakes ("the Sweepstakes"), visit the Algonquin Books web site located here between 12:01 a.m. ET on October 15, 2004 and 11:59 p.m. ET on March 4, 2005, and complete the Official On-Line Entry Form. No purchase, entry fee, or payment is necessary to enter the Sweepstakes. No mechanically reproduced entries will be accepted. Limit one (1) entry per person/e-mail account.
One grand-prize winner will receive a travel package for two consisting of round-trip Economy Class tickets on Alitalia Airlines from one of Alitalia's U.S.A. gateways (New York's JFK, Newark, Washington D.C., Boston, Chicago, or Miami) to Florence or Pisa, Italy, and three (3) nights standard double-occupancy hotel accommodation in the destination city. (approximate retail value: $3,000).
